Launch of an Ambitious New Fundraising Campaign: 'Dare to Do Different'
Our new £100 million fundraising campaign, ‘Dare to Do Different,’ was launched in October at UEA Court. Building on the success of the ‘Difference Campaign’, this new initiative continues UEA’s proud tradition of philanthropic support for key projects and research, focusing on four key areas: Climate, Health, Creative, and Campus.
The initiative was introduced by Dame Jenny Abramsky GBE (ENG65), UEA’s Chancellor and Campaign Chair, who reflected on her time at UEA and expressed her pride in spearheading this bold campaign. UEA Vice-Chancellor Prof David Maguire and David Ellis (NBS09), Director of Development, Alumni and Campaigns, also presented updates on the University's strategy and how 'Dare to Do Different' will support projects that advance education, research, and student success.
As part of UEA’s Vision 2030, this new campaign will address some of the world’s most pressing issues, from tackling climate change to advancing health innovations. Over the coming years, philanthropic support will enable groundbreaking research, student scholarships, new capital projects on campus, and support for our student community.
We are proud to share that the campaign has already secured £20 million, setting us firmly on the path toward our £100 million target. UEA has always dared to be different, and with this campaign, we continue to embrace that bold mission.
